在 SolidWorks 中,通过 限制距离配合(Limit Distance Mate) 可以限制两个零部件之间的相对运动范围,使其只能在设定的最小和最大距离之间移动。
操作步骤
打开装配体,确保要配合的两个零部件已插入。
点击 “配合”(位于装配体工具栏)或选择 插入 > 配合。
在 PropertyManager 中,点击 “高级配合” 选项卡。
选择 “距离” 作为配合类型。
选择两个要限制距离的 配合实体(通常是两个平面、面或基准面)。
设置以下参数:起始距离:配合创建时的初始距离(可选)。
最大距离:允许的最大间距。
最小距离:允许的最小间距。
勾选 “反转尺寸”(如需将实体移至另一侧)。
点击 “确定” 完成配合。
补充说明
设计表控制:可在设计表中通过列如 D1@LimitDistance1、$UPPERLIMIT_DISTANCE@LimitDistance1、$LOWERLIMIT_DISTANCE@LimitDistance1 来动态设置限制值
动态间隙检查:若需在手动拖动零件时实时监控最小距离,可使用 “移动零部件” + “指定间隙停止” 功能
柔性配合建议:对于气缸、滑块等需模拟伸缩运动的场景,推荐使用限制距离配合并设置零部件为 “柔性”,便于观察不同位置下的干涉情况
常见应用场景
导轨滑块的行程限制(如最小 0 mm,最大 140 mm)
活塞在气缸内的运动限位
同步带轮沿带宽方向的定位
如需视频演示,可参考:SW宽度配合实战讲解